OSHA defines a “serious” violation as “one in which there is a substantial probability that death or serious physical … WebApr 13, 2024 · Fines for failing to protect workers from on-the-job falls surged 25 percent to $36.2 million in 2024. The regulation requiring fall protection topped the U.S. Occupational Safety and Health Administration’s list of most-violated rules for the 12th straight year.
WebNov 15, 2024 · View OSHA’s 2024 Top 10 violations, with fall protection being number 1. Numbers 2-5 are hazard communication, respiratory protection, ladders and scaffolding. Numbers 6-10 are lockout/tagout, powered industrial trucks, fall protection training, personal protective and lifesaving equipment and machine guarding.
